Prelims in 02 and 03 a GF in 07 and finals on 00 and 06 on top of his Premiership in 04.

Taking all that into account I think 10 years at any club is about the limit,unless at the end of that 10 year period the club is top 2 or 3. I think Williams will have next year to get Port finals bound and then,if we do not make finals,his contract may (IMO) not be extended.

It is fair to say Williams has a strong hold on all goins on at Port Adelaide and thats fine for me as a the coach of a football club should not have too many people,if any overseeing or second guessing his agenda.

The question should be,how long will the Port Adelaide heirachy allow Williams to run the operation as he does now?

or,

Will Williams burnout as a result of his lack of willingness to delegate?
